About Me

Experience Summary

My BA was earned at a small, independent, private college in Los Angeles. My major is in English, with a minor in Psychology and Sociology. I have a Master’s degree in Elementary Education, which was completed in 18 months. I have also passed the following educational tests in the state of California: CBEST, CSET (Multiple Subject), and RICA. (Reading Instruction Comprehensive Assessment). I have over 2,000 hours of in-home tutoring experience, in a wide variety of subjects with a full spectrum of student age ranges. In six years I have tutored students from first grade to High School, in subjects ranging from phonics, and reading comprehension to mathematics and algebra. I have taught for a year at an EDD (Emotionally and Developmentally Disabled) High School for students with many varying issues. I have been a substitute teacher for two years, in which time I have taught classes from Kindergarten Special Education to High School Algebra. Due to my experience, my teaching style varies with each individual student, becoming adaptable and flexible with each student’s learning style.

Teaching Style

My teaching style is adaptive, changing with the needs of the individual student. Since each student learns in a different manner, so have I learned to adapt my teaching to each individual student. Additionally, I ensure that while tutoring I bolster and reinforce the self-esteem of the student. Many times, the fact that a tutor is necessary may lead the student to the erroneous assumption that something is wrong with the student. My experience and teaching style is to celebrate every single student learning victory.
